>>>>>>>>> Looking at the docs, it is kinda hard to find a new-to-weewx 
>>>>>>>>> getting started guide to spin up on the terminology.
>>>>>>>>>
>>>>>>>>> The word you're looking for is 'skin' which is a user-installable 
>>>>>>>>> set of files that generate a particular set of web content results.  
>>>>>>>>> You 
>>>>>>>>> install skins typically with the 'wee_extension' utility.   Some 
>>>>>>>>> skins are 
>>>>>>>>> in the weewx showcase at https://weewx.com/showcase.html as well 
>>>>>>>>> as if you dig through the map at https://weewx.com/stations.html 
>>>>>>>>> and poke around a bit.
>>>>>>>>>
>>>>>>>>> Most people really like Belchertown but there are many (so many) 
>>>>>>>>> great ones out there you can spend days trying them out.
